Take a Picture

You can take pictures with your phone's front or back camera, or combine shots with Dual
mode.
1. Press
and tap
2. Using the phone's screen as a viewfinder, compose your shot by aiming the camera at
the subject. While composing your picture, use the on-screen options, or these gestures:
Press the Volume Key up or down to zoom in or out, or touch the screen with two
fingers and pinch or spread them on the screen to zoom in or out.
Tap the screen to focus on the area you tapped.
3. Tap
Capture to take the picture.
